How To Evaluate Your Needs Before Buying Fences

Looking to buy a new fence can be a bewildering experience, and that's a known fact. Failing to completely think through your goals or what you want the fence to do is very common. Believe it or not but fences to serve different functions for your home and property. Perhaps you're more interested in the beauty of your garden and how the right fence can complement what you already have.

There are some community matters to take care of before the fence appears in the back garden. Generally speaking, there should not be any issues at all with your neighbor friends, but it's safe to make sure your fence will not interfere with their property. And if there are zoning compliance requirements, what that means is you have to use a fence that is acceptable to whatever the laws state. There really are no laws, to my knowledge, that states you can't have a fence if the neighbor objects, but it's a nice gesture.
